面对2026年iOS开发岗位的激烈竞争,一次成功的面试往往始于周密的准备。本文旨在为你提供一份结构清晰、可执行的分步指南,重点解答“iOS开发面试前需要做些什么准备?”这一核心问题,并融入关键避坑要点,帮助你将技术实力高效转化为录用通知。
第一步:系统性技术复习与知识更新(夯实基础)
技术能力是iOS开发面试的基石。2026年的面试官不仅考察你的编码功底,更关注你对技术演进的洞察与适应能力。本步骤将技术准备分解为可操作的层面。
巩固核心iOS开发技能栈
无论面试岗位侧重何方,Swift语言特性、内存管理(ARC)、多线程(GCD/Operation)、常用设计模式(如MVC、MVVM)以及核心框架(UIKit/SwiftUI、Foundation)都是必考项。建议你梳理近两年的项目,用代码片段重新诠释关键技术点的应用,而非仅背诵概念。例如,针对资深开发者,可以准备一个复杂状态管理或性能优化的实战案例,并量化其效果。
跟踪2026年iOS生态前沿趋势
面试官常通过新技术话题评估候选人的学习主动性。你需要关注Swift的稳定ABI进展、SwiftUI与Combine的深度整合、以及增强现实(ARKit)或机器学习(Core ML)在业务中的创新应用。订阅官方开发者博客、参与技术社区讨论,并尝试在个人项目或代码仓库中实践一项新特性,这能成为面试中的突出亮点。
第二步:简历精准优化与作品集打造(提升过筛率)
一份与岗位高度匹配的简历是获得面试机会的前提。许多优秀开发者因简历未能通过ATS(简历筛选系统)或HR的快速扫描而“秒挂”。本步骤聚焦于将你的经历转化为机器与人都青睐的叙事。
使用AI工具实现岗位关键词对齐
手动逐条比对岗位要求(JD)耗时且易遗漏。你可以借助如“AI简历姬”这类求职工作台来提升效率。具体操作是:将你的旧简历(PDF或Word格式)导入,系统会自动解析并结构化你的经历;随后,粘贴目标岗位的JD,工具会逐条分析JD关键词,并与你的经历进行智能对齐,给出匹配度评分、关键词覆盖率及缺口清单。这能直观揭示你的简历与岗位的差距,避免因信息不对题而被筛除。
量化改写与构建说服力作品集
基于关键词缺口,你需要对经历进行成果导向的改写。例如,将“负责了某功能开发”优化为“采用SwiftUI重构登录模块,使页面渲染性能提升20%,用户投诉率降低15%”。AI简历姬的量化改写功能可辅助你快速生成STAR结构(情境、任务、行动、结果)的初稿。同时,整理一个精炼的GitHub仓库或作品集链接,确保代码整洁、有README说明,并优先展示与目标岗位最相关的项目。
第三步:全方位模拟面试与避坑实战(稳握offer)
技术过关后,面试现场的临场表现至关重要。本步骤优先解决面试准备中的个性化难题,并提供避坑策略。
优先使用AI模拟面试进行个性化演练
泛泛的面试题练习往往不够。针对iOS开发面试,你可以利用“AI简历姬”中的AI模拟面试功能。该功能基于你上传的简历和目标岗位JD,自动生成定制化的技术追问、业务场景题及行为面试问题,并提供参考回答与反馈建议。其数据库涵盖1000+岗位的3万多面试题库,能模拟技术面、主管面、HR面全流程,甚至包括薪资谈判环节。通过这种针对性演练,你可以提前暴露知识盲区,优化表达逻辑。已有100+用户通过此方法成功拿到offer。
识别常见陷阱与学会反向验证
面试不仅是回答问题,更是评估团队与岗位的过程。避坑要点包括:一、避免在技术讨论中死记硬背,转而展示解决问题的思维过程;二、在反问环节,通过询问团队技术栈、项目复盘机制、晋升路径等问题,来验证岗位的成长性与团队健康度。例如,你可以问:“团队目前如何平衡SwiftUI与UIKit的技术债?”这能帮你判断技术决策的合理性。AI简历姬的面试模块也提供了此类反向提问的建议清单,助你主动规避潜在“坑位”。
总结
iOS开发面试前的准备是一个从技术深度、简历匹配到临场发挥的闭环过程。2026年的成功候选人,往往能系统化复习核心技术、用工具精准优化简历以通过ATS筛选,并通过模拟面试提前适应真实场景。建议你按上述步骤规划1-2周时间,并可使用AI简历姬这类工具将“投递—面试—复盘”做成可管理闭环,从而全面提升拿Offer的概率。
常见问题解答(FAQ)
iOS开发面试前需要做些什么准备?核心步骤是什么?
核心准备可分为三步:1. 系统性技术复习,包括核心技能巩固和前沿趋势跟踪;2. 简历与作品集优化,确保与岗位要求关键词对齐并量化成果;3. 全方位模拟面试,通过个性化演练熟悉流程并学会反向提问。这三大步骤覆盖了从知识储备到现场表现的全过程。
如何快速让简历通过ATS筛选?
关键是实现简历文本与岗位JD的高度匹配。建议使用专业工具如AI简历姬进行关键词对齐诊断,它会自动解析JD并对比你的经历,给出匹配度评分和缺口清单。然后,依据建议进行STAR结构化改写,并导出ATS友好的PDF格式(确保文本可抓取)。避免使用复杂图表或非常规字体,以提升机器解析率。
AI简历姬的模拟面试功能对iOS开发面试有何具体帮助?
该功能能基于你的具体简历和目标岗位(如“iOS高级开发工程师”),生成高度相关的技术问题(如Swift并发编程、架构设计)和业务场景题。它模拟真实面试流程,提供追问和反馈,帮助你提前演练技术深度、项目阐述及行为回答。此外,它还涵盖如何谈薪资、如何反问团队信息等环节,使准备更全面,减少临场失误。
对于转行或初级iOS开发者,准备重点有何不同?
转行或初级开发者应更侧重基础技能的扎实展示和项目实践。准备时:1. 强化Swift语法和UIKit基础,通过小型应用(如待办事项、天气App)证明编码能力;2. 在简历中突出学习能力与项目动机,使用工具如AI简历姬将非相关经历转化为可转移技能;3. 在模拟面试中多练习基础概念和简单项目阐述,避免过度追求前沿技术而忽略核心。
面试中如何判断一个iOS开发岗位是否有成长性?
可通过反向提问来评估:询问团队的技术选型理由(如为何采用某架构)、代码评审与技术分享频率、以及个人成长路径(如是否有 mentor 制度)。例如,问“团队在适配新iOS版本时的技术决策流程是什么?”能揭示技术管理的成熟度。结合AI简历姬提供的反问建议,你可以更系统地收集信息,避免加入技术停滞或管理混乱的团队。
评论 (17)
非常实用的文章,感谢分享!
谢谢支持!
请问有没有针对应届生的简历模板推荐?刚毕业没什么工作经验,不知道怎么写比较好。